## Who to ping about GiftNote

Welcome aboard! GiftNote is our donation-receipt mailer for the Larchfield Fund. Template tweaks go to the comms folks; delivery failures and bounce weirdness go to the platform crew. Don't push template changes on Fridays — receipts batch over the weekend. For anything GiftNote-related, start with the address below.

billing contact of kaweg-tajeg = drudor.lamion.oliath@torvalabs.test

The fix is banker's rounding applied once, at the final display step, with all intermediate math carried at nine decimal places in fixed-point. Reconciliation against the Tallow clearing feed now tolerates a bounded per-invoice delta. Precision, tolerance, and scaling factors are centralized so plugins never hardcode them. The current production values follow.

tuning constants:
BUDGETS = {
    "druath": 240,
    "lamwyn": 180,
    "silael": 275,
}

**Release checklist — Step 7: Broker upgrade.** Before cutting over, drain the Quillhopper queue cluster and confirm zero in-flight messages on both mirrors. Upgrade the standby node first, verify replication lag stays under two seconds for five minutes, then promote it. If consumers reconnect cleanly, proceed; otherwise roll back immediately. Record the post-upgrade verification run using the token below.

pipeline stamp: htk21_86b657ac0aa916a9af17f

MEMO — Sales Leads Only

We are in early discussions to acquire Pellbrook Analytics. Nothing is signed; diligence starts next month. For now, continue selling the Harrowmere suite as normal and do not alter pricing or roadmap commitments in customer conversations. If a prospect mentions Pellbrook, take no position and escalate to me. Expect a full briefing once terms firm up. The reasoning behind the deal is noted confidentially below.

internal memo for fajog-yagaf: Gross margin on Ulaael came in at 20 percent against a plan of 10 percent. Only 9 of the 80 pilot accounts renewed Ulaael, so a churn review is set for July 1.